Job Description

Internal Closing Date: Tuesday 9th December 2025

Why this job matters

As a Financial Reporting Manager, you will play a pivotal role in providing Contract Accountant support across a range of contracts within the Devolved Nations area of the UK S&C Public Sector business. Acting as a key business partner to operational sales teams and the Devolved Nations Senior Finance Manager, you will drive performance through insightful financial analysis, robust reporting, and strong commercial challenge. You will oversee financial control, forecasting, and budgeting for these contracts, ensuring accurate reporting, revenue assurance, and effective performance tracking while influencing both tactical and strategic decision-making across the business.

What you’ll be doing

  • Provide end-to-end financial control and oversight on major contracts in the Devolved Nations.
  • Partner closely with the Senior Finance Manager, Sales Directors, and their teams to align financial performance with strategic and operational goals.
  • Produce monthly reporting packs for Devolved Nations contracts, including CGRs and operational reviews, with clear, insightful commentary.
  • Develop, own, and continuously refine detailed forecasts, outlooks, and budgets, incorporating WIP, new deals, churn, and customer insights.
  • Review performance versus bid, ensuring robust commercial and accounting controls (accruals, revenue recognition, balance sheet, and P&L) across contracts.

The skills you'll need

  • Qualified accountant (CIMA, ACA, ACCA or equivalent).
  • Proven experience in financial reporting, analysis and contract accounting within a complex business environment.
  • Strong stakeholder management and business partnering skills, with the ability to influence senior leaders and challenge constructively.
  • Excellent analytical, forecasting and budgeting skills, with high attention to detail and the ability to translate financial data into clear, actionable insight.
